Drake kicked off his partnership with Apple Music in a powerful way this weekend with a pile of exclusives — the insanely cool music video for "Energy," an interview with Zane Lowe where he debuted a new single with Majid Jordan plus the launch of his own Beats 1 Radio show, OVO SOUND.
The "Energy" video, which recalls Michael Jackson's epic "Black or White," features flawless CGI that has Drake morphing into everyone from Justin Bieber to Miley Cyrus and Oprah, Kanye, Ken Doll, and Lebron James. The video, directed by Fleur & Manu, is an Apple Music exclusive, of course.
Saturday's inaugural episode of the OVO SOUND Beats 1 radio show offered a real glimpse inside this tight-knit Toronto crew. Assisted by OVO co-founder Oliver El-Khatib and PRIME producer Eric Dingus, Drizzy delivered a solid two-hour show—during which he debuted three more new records while discussing ongoing recording for the hotly anticipated Views From The Six.
"That's one of the joys we get out of life you know, myself and Oliver, we play each other music," he said as he kicked off his show, "we always wanna bring it from our heart directly where you're at."
